Questions to ask about pricing before signing
When hiring an accident lawyer in Glendale, California, crucial ask the right questions about pricing to avoid unexpected costs later on.
- What is your fee structure, and how do you charge for your services?
- Are there any additional costs besides your fees that I should be aware of?
- Can I get a written estimate of the total costs involved in handling my case?
Failure to inquire about all potential expenses upfront can lead to financial surprises during your legal proceedings, which could result in dissatisfaction with the legal services provided.
Frequently Asked Questions
What are the typical costs of hiring an accident lawyer?
Typically, hiring an accident lawyer in Glendale can range from $200 to $500 per hour, or 33-40% of the settlement in contingency cases, depending on the complexity.
What payment options are available for legal services?
Many lawyers offer contingency fees, flat rates, or hourly billing, with financing options available to help manage costs.
What costs are usually included in legal fees?
Legal fees often cover attorney time, court costs, expert witnesses, and administrative expenses, but clients should clarify specifics with their lawyer.
